Steve Gilligan Boston, Massachusetts

Steve Gilligan is best known as bassist of legendary Boston rock 'n' roll band The Stompers. He's released 4 solo CDs; "Jacobs Well", “Winter Rain”, “Dogpatch Garage”, and now "Next Someday", which rocks with a melodic energy found in the best from bands like Tom Petty & XTC. ... more
